Pirates To Designate Chase Shugart For Assignment
The Pirates are designating reliever Chase Shugart for assignment, reports Jason Mackey of The Pittsburgh Post-Gazette. They needed to create a 40-man roster spot for Ryan O’Hearn, whose two-year free agent contract was finalized this afternoon. Pittsburgh acquired the 29-year-old Shugart in a minor trade with the Red Sox last offseason.
